I once saw a DWM that was in the white and had no markings whatsoever. It was assumed to be a "lunch box special".
Since the DWM's were manufactured before 1934 it predated the US federal requirement for a serial number and was presumably legal. I'd be careful with it if I had it though, the average law enforcement offcier would probably not be well versed in the fine points of the law and after the dust settled, you might get it back with police property room marks engraved on it with an electro buzzer. |
